Emergency Contact Safe Ports Home Latest updates Publications Safe Ports 9 Aug 2023 View PDF Sign up for alerts Both time and voyage charterparties will normally place charterers under an obligation to order the ship to proceed to ports which are safe. Safe port disputes are normally complex and fact sensitive.
